Five UK publishers awarded Literary Translation support

Five UK-based publishing organisations are being awarded €245,000 to produce, promote and translate slates of literary works from one European language to another.
In the results of 2018's Literary Translation call, a strand in Creative Europe's Culture sub-programme, publishing houses from England and Wales are among those selected for either Slate or Framework Partnership Agreement (FPA) funding.

Creative Europe project helps PRS Foundation CEO join Beyonce in BBC Power List

Vanessa Reed of PRS Foundation has won the number three spot on the BBC Woman’s Hour Power List of the 40 most powerful women in the music industry.
The top five on the list are Beyoncé, Taylor Swift, Vanessa Reed, CEO of the PRS Foundation, Adele and Stacey Tang, Managing Director of RCA UK.
PRS Foundation is the lead partner in Creative Europe-supported Cooperation Project Keychange, which promotes the role of women in music and raises awareness of the gender gap in music across Europe.

Open call for choreographers: Aerowaves Twenty

Aerowaves is a Creative Europe-supported hub for dance discovery in Europe with a network of partners in 33 countries. The network is looking for the next 20 talented emerging choreographers based in geographical Europe.
You can now apply to become a Twenty19 artist with a chance of having your work programmed at Spring Forward Festival in 2020 in Val de Marne (Paris’ region) and by the Aerowaves partners.
